Is it too ;te to try and reclaim

Hi everyone I'm new here and have a few questions, I hope someone can help me with.

I know for certain that my husband has been missold on ppi's in the past as he was a serving soldier and would have been paid indeffinatly if he was off work sick, that's just for starters, I am sure there will be others reasons. The problem is it's longer than 6 years ago, some loans could be up to 15 years, he's had a few. They are all with LLoyds as he has had the same bank and branch for the lasy 35 years.

Does anyone have any experience with this and also would a claim make any difference to our relationship with the bank.

Hope someone can help as it must be thousand, although I am probably far too late as I don't have any paperwork now.

Any info would be greatly appreciated.

    Hi There.

    Have a look on Experian which holds your credit score. Join up to gewt the info on all your financial history which includes account no's etc. Do not forget to sign the DD when you have this info otherwise you will have to pay every month. Then once you have that info you could write to LLoyds with the account numbers and tell them you felt you had been mis sold and the reasons why. You have nothing to lose on this and hopefully you may get some of the PPI repaid to you.

    It should not harm your relationship with your bank. It is their fault if these were mis sold. Good luck to you.

    In regards of PPI reclaiming, the link below is very useful, you will find the guidelines of reclaiming, a checklist of mis selling reasons, (write all that occurs to you), and reclaim template letters, you can use them if you want to, or as a guide and they have 8 weeks in full to respond,
    Best as well to post by recorded delivery - this is your proof of posting.
    http://www.moneysavingexpert.com/reclaim/ppi-loan-insurance

    If the loan is with the same broker/provider, if the reasons are all the same, you can write on the one letter, but to include all the loan account numbers where mis sold etc.

    If you do not have the paperwork, firstly ask by calling into your local branch for these, they may give them free of charge this way.

    Another way is to request a Subject Access Request (SAR), where they have 40 days to comply and send everything they hold on you.
    If you bank with them, just write your banking account number and they should send all info on all loans you taken out, and credit cards and so on.
    There is a £10 charge for this payable in postal order or cheque payment, again post by recorded delivery.
